Preoperative

Risk for Hypothermia related to the disease condition.

Possibly evidenced by

  • Loss of heat and fluid from large area of exposed sac.
  • Cool skin.
  • Body temperature lower than normal range.

Desired outcome

  • Childs temperature will remain above 97.8° F

Nursing interventions

  • Monitor vital signs.
  • Provide rafiant warmer.
  • Educate parents about the appropriate amount of clothing required for the child.
  • Asses temperature of the extremity.

Post-operative

Risk for infection related to entry of pathogenic organisms due to bacterial invasion of the neural tube sac.

Desired outcome

  • Child will not experience Infection

Nursing Interventions

  • Assess neural tube sac for breaks or leakage of CSF
  • Assess for fever, irritability, nuchal rigidity.
  • Observe changes in the wound following surgical repair of the defect.
  • After surgery, cleanse round with as antiseptics as ordered and change dressings when needed using sterile technique for at least 24 hours.
